Why This Comparison Doesn't Work
An email finder takes a person's name and company domain, then returns a probable email address. That's Wiza: a discovery tool for sales teams building prospect lists from scratch.

An email verifier takes an address you already have and tells you whether it'll bounce, hit a catch-all server, or land in a real inbox. That's UnwrapEmail: an API-level validation service built for developers preventing bad signups.

What Is Wiza?
Wiza is a lead prospecting platform that finds email addresses and phone numbers from professional profiles. Its Chrome extension workflow gets called out constantly on G2 - 427 mentions tied to ease of use and the extension-based experience, plus a 4.5/5 rating from 1,142 reviewers.
Pros: Strong accuracy, intuitive browser workflow, solid G2 social proof. Cons: "Expensive" appears 157 times in G2 cons. "Limited credits" shows up 127 times. Small teams hit ceilings fast.
- Free: 20 emails/mo + 5 phone numbers
- Starter: $49/user/mo - 100 emails + 100 phones (extra emails $0.15 per 100; extra phones $0.35 each)
- Email: $99/user/mo - 500 emails (phones $0.35 each)
- Email + Phone: $199/user/mo - 500 emails + 500 phones (extra emails $0.15 per 100; extra phones $0.35 each)
The annual Email plan ($990/year) advertises "unlimited emails" but caps exports at 30,000 per year - roughly 2,500 contacts per month. Calling that "unlimited" is generous branding at best.

What Is UnwrapEmail?
UnwrapEmail is a pure-play email verification API. No dashboard, no Chrome extension, no UI to speak of. You authenticate via API key, send an email address, and get back a verification verdict with flags for disposable and role-based addresses, based on MX verification, SMTP provider identification, and Unicode pattern flagging.

The tool was built to combat free-plan abuse via disposable emails and Gmail "+" tricks. It maintains a database of 500K+ disposable domains refreshed multiple times daily and has processed 75M+ verifications. A Q3 2025 edge runtime migration cut cold starts by 40% and reduced redundant MX queries by roughly half.
Pros: Aggressively cheap at low volume, fast response times, generous free tier. Cons: No G2 or Capterra profile, no independent accuracy benchmarks. One Reddit user flagged a missed disposable domain ("fake.legal"), which isn't a great look for a tool whose entire job is catching those. Costs scale after 50K at $0.001 per validation - still cheap, but worth modeling at high volume.
Pricing:
- Free: 1,000 validations/month
- $25 flat: up to 50,000 validations
- ~$75: up to 100,000 validations
For context, ZeroBounce charges ~$350 for 50K validations. UnwrapEmail is 14x cheaper at that tier.

Is Wiza's "unlimited" email plan really unlimited?
The annual Email plan ($990/year) caps exports at 30,000/year - about 2,500 contacts per month. For a multi-rep team running outbound at scale, that ceiling arrives within the first quarter.
Does UnwrapEmail have a dashboard or Chrome extension?
No. It's API-only, built for engineers validating signups rather than sales reps building lists. You'll need to integrate it into your own application via API key authentication.
